Cached MSOs
This page includes the configuration for one or more Cached MSOs that can be created to persist data retrieved from the federated environment using either Build the Query or Advanced mode. In other words, it’s a way to eliminate long-running processes retrieving data in a federated environment in a live production environment, but instead loading data from one or more MSOs into Cached MSOs that can then be accessed “locally” to the AO Platform. Such Cached MSOs can be refreshed both manually and on schedule.
